Sustainable Facade Materials
Modern architecture increasingly seeks to reduce its carbon footprint. A key area of focus is facade materials, the very element that defines a building's exterior. Going mere aesthetics, these materials must be chosen strategically for their strength and eco-consciousness to the environment.
- Investigate innovative materials like reclaimed wood, recycled plastics, or bio-based composites that offer both visual appeal and green benefits.
- Employ green building technologies into the facade design, such as solar panels or living walls, to utilize renewable energy and promote biodiversity.
- Emphasize materials with a low embodied carbon footprint, considering the complete life cycle from extraction to recycling.

Performance Meets Style: High-Tech Facade Systems
Modern architecture favors a dynamic approach, where building facades are no longer just protective barriers. Instead, they've evolved into sophisticated systems that seamlessly integrate performance and style. High-tech facade systems showcase this shift, offering a variety of innovative solutions to enhance both the functionality and visual appeal of buildings.
These advanced facades employ cutting-edge materials and technologies such as smart glass, dynamic shading devices, and integrated sensors to create adaptive building envelopes. This allows for precise control over click here natural light, ventilation, and thermal performance, resulting in cost savings and improved occupant comfort.
